
Thomas Partey's chances of staying at Arsenal are in doubt as contract negotiations with the club stall.
The Ghana international's contract at the club runs out at the end of this month.
Partey joined the Premier League side on a five-year deal from Atletico Madrid in 2020.
Following the conclusion of the 2024/25 Premier League season, the club confirmed that they are in talks with the representatives of the 31-year-old midfielder over a possible contract extension.
However, transfer guru Fabrizio Romano has revealed that there is no agreement between the camps.
He added that Partey could leave the London club prior to the start of the 2025-2026 season.
Meanwhile, European clubs and Saudi clubs have expressed interest in Partey.
However, Gabby Otchere-Darko, a renowned Ghanaian lawyer and a staunch Arsenal has advised Partey to consider his options and leave the club.
“I’m an Arsenal fan, but I advise Thomas Partey to move elsewhere and make some good money for his pension years,” he said on Asaase Radio.
